We are looking for someone to help us maintain the properties we look after. Your role will be to help make sure these homes are maintained to a high standard for the people who live in them.

You will be working on properties across Hackney. Some of these homes will be occupied but you will also be helping us prepare others for their new occupants. To be able to do this work, you need a variety of maintenance skills. We need someone who has a good level of carpentry, plumbing, plastering, glazing, painting and decorating skills. Having a recognised qualification in one of these trades would be desirable.

Some of this work is physically demanding, you may need to climb ladders and lift heavy objects. You will need to apply a sensible approach to your work, be able to manage your time and take pride in your work.

You will need experience in repairs and maintenance perhaps for a Housing Association, Local Authority or as a contractor working in tenant’s homes. You need to hold a full UK driving licence (maximum 3 penalty points) as we will provide you with a work vehicle. You should have NVQ Level 2 in Maintenance Operations or similar City and Guilds qualification or relevant experience. You will also need to have IT skills as you may be using a hand held device to record your work.

In return you will get great opportunities for training, generous annual leave and the opportunity to earn up to £47,864pa on a productivity related pay scheme. Successful candidates will start on £42,087 pa, please note the salary is dependent on productivity and your salary may vary between £28,775 and £47,864 pa.
